Originally established in 1967 as Imperial Plastics and located in Evansville, Indiana, Berry Plastics has grown into a leading manufacturer of injection-molded plastic packaging, thermoformed products, flexible films and tapes and coatings. The company's sales are focused in four divisions:
Imperial Plastics became Berry Plastics when it was purchased in 1983 by Jack Berry, Sr., a Florida-based citrus grower and real estate developer. In 1987, Berry opened a second manufacturing facility in Henderson, Nevada. Gilbert Plastics of New Brunswick, New Jersey, a manufacturer of aerosol overcaps, was Berry's first acquisition in 1988. Berry has grown through acquisitions and organic growth. In 2006, the investment groups, Apollo Management L.P. and Graham Partners, Inc., purchased Berry Plastics Corporation. The management team of Berry Plastics is also a significant investor. |
